How WChat Automates Insurance Renewal Reminders
1. Send Renewal Reminders Before the Due Date
WChat can automatically send reminders based on predefined schedules, such as:
- 30 days before expiry
- 15 days before expiry
- 7 days before expiry
- 3 days before expiry
- On the renewal date
- After expiry, where permitted
This ensures customers receive multiple opportunities to complete the renewal.
2. Share Important Policy Details
The WhatsApp message can include:
- Customer name
- Policy number
- Insurance type
- Renewal due date
- Premium amount
- Coverage summary
- Renewal status
- Contact details for assistance
Customers receive the information required to take action without searching through previous documents.

Example Insurance Renewal Journey
A customer receives a WhatsApp message:
Hello Rahul, your motor insurance policy is due for renewal on 25 August. Your renewal premium is βΉ8,450. Would you like to renew now or speak with an advisor?
The customer can select:
- Renew Now
- View Policy Details
- Request a Callback
- Ask a Question
If the customer chooses Renew Now, WChat shares a secure payment link.
If the customer selects Request a Callback, the enquiry is assigned to an insurance advisor with complete context.

Important Compliance Considerations
Insurance renewal messages should be sent only to customers who have provided the required consent or where communication is permitted under applicable regulations.
Businesses should also:
- Use approved WhatsApp message templates
- Avoid sharing sensitive personal data unnecessarily
- Use secure payment links
- Provide clear opt-out instructions
- Follow insurance and data protection requirements
- Ensure policy information comes from verified systems
WChat acts as the communication and workflow automation platform. Policy pricing, eligibility, coverage, and renewal decisions remain with the insurance provider.
